i am a third year student of mechanical engineering.i want to know the current job scenario for freshers in automobile industry and what should i do to get into companies such as Tata,hero etc. and what could i do to improve my resume?
Hi Rahul,
Who better than you would be able to gauge the job scenario currently. Since you are a student, you would be well aware of the market, as you would be in touch with professionals and or batch mates and are regularly surfing the net and reading the papers.
Though I am well aware, that you might not be following it thoroughly, but here I would request you to keep a note of the market, since you just have a year to go.
Hoping there is a placement in the University, should ease you out, but still keeping a tab is important.At the same time, follow with the ex campus placement to note which companies hired students and their job roles and designations offered.
In the meanwhile, if you could meet professionals, and this can be done online through Linked-IN, or any other social networking sites, you would get a first hand information.At the same time, opt for internship programs during vacation. This is another way to know about the current scenario.
As far as getting into the top notch organizations like TATA etc. Firstly go through their websites and check the Career section and try and upload your Resume in that portal. Mostly references work for getting into these organizations.Another way is to participate in annual workshops whereby companies attend to see and select students and professionals based on their work that they showcase during such seminars and workshops. Try and participate in such seminars and or workshops.
At the same time, prepare an attractive Resume. It should highlight all your achievements during college and other organizations you have worked for. You can also speak about your contributions during internship.Prepare a covering letter and along with your Resume, send it to the organizations.
At the same time, I would suggests, work on gaining knowledge. So try and join in any organization, whereby the focus should be on learning and acquiring knowledge. At the same time be innovative and keep applying.
